Why Some Cannot Enter the System?
In many countries, especially developing countries, overseas education is seen as a symbol of personal achievement and a route to higher social status. However, simply having an overseas education background does not guarantee employment opportunities in the official system. Sometimes, it is due to the lack of job openings and fierce competition, whereas, in other cases, it is due to different ideologies or biases.
Alternative Career Paths
For those who cannot enter the official system, alternative career paths are worth exploring. For instance, if one has a degree in education, they could pursue a career in tutoring or opening up their own education center. Alternatively, one could establish their own business, either in their field of study or completely unrelated to it. Freelancing is also an option, and more and more people are joining the gig economy, offering services like content creation, graphic design, or programming.
Building Networks and Volunteering
Networking and volunteering are two ways to gain experience and broaden one's horizons. Establishing connections in one's field, whether domestically or internationally, can help one learn about potential job openings and can lead to referrals. Volunteering, on the other hand, can help one refine skills, gain experience, and improve their resume. Moreover, volunteering can be a great way to give back to the community and make a positive impact.
Continuing Education
Continuing one's education is another path to consider, especially if one's education is related to a particular skillset. Pursuing a higher degree can help one acquire more in-depth knowledge and can improve one's chances of securing a more specialized job. Alternatively, one could choose to attend training courses or workshops that provide hands-on experience and practical knowledge. Furthermore, some groups or organizations offer training to help refine one's skills and stay up-to-date with the latest trends and techniques.
